2026《两轮自平衡车的软件设计案例分析》3400字.docx

2026《两轮自平衡车的软件设计案例分析》3400字.docx

两轮自平衡车的软件设计案例分析

1.1开发环境的介绍

本次开发环境使用的是Keil5,因为Keil5能生成.hex文件的软件,STM32单片机需要hex文件,所以选择keil5作为本次设计的编译工具。

1.2程序设计的总体方案

程序功能主要包括对各个传感器信号的采集和处理;汽车交通控制、垂直控制、速度控制、转向控制、障碍物预防控制;PWM发动机输出;汽车循环过程控制:启动程序、汽车启动和结束、汽车状态监控;车辆信息对话框及参数配置:状态查看器、上位机监控、参数配置等。

上述功能可分为两类:第一类包括前三类功能。所有这些函数都是在一个精确的时间周期内运行的,因此它们可以在一个周期内中断。第二

文档评论(0)

1亿VIP精品文档

相关文档